I tried your >>>> example_GC_istvan.py file with MMGT_OPT set to 0, but it does not >>>> crash. >>>> >>> >>> On OSX/pythonocc current master/OCE-0.6.0, crash with MMGT_OPT=0, >>> MMGT_OPT=2 but succeed with MMGT_OPT=1. >>> >>> >>>> >>>> > Last night I have been profiling some pythonocc code and I have >>>> noticed that >>>> > collect_object is a quite slow even if I remove logging. Probably it >>>> has >>>> > some potential to increase pythonocc's performance. Since it is always >>>> > called when an object is destructed it makes sense to remove somehow >>>> the >>>> > costly string compares for the Handle objects. For example if it is >>>> possible >>>> > in OCE in the Handle class generator (handle classes are generated >>>> > automatically, aren't they?) can be modified that every Handle class >>>> should >>>> > subclass from an empty marker class (eg. class HandleMarkerClass{}) >>>> and this >>>> > can be used in the GC by checking only >>>> > isinstance(obj_deleted,HandleMarkerClass), removing >>>> > the obj_deleted.__class__.__name__.startswith('Handle'). >>>> >>>> AFAICT all handles derive from either Handle_Standard_Transient or >>>> Handle_Standard_Persistent, so your solution can be implemented >>>> without changes in C++ code. >>>> >>>> > The hasattr calls >>>> > might also can be replaced by some tricky way but I don't know if it >>>> worth >>>> > it but I think it does since hasattr searches in a python dictionary >>>> which >>>> > is a hashmap and a single isinstance is might be less costly than a >>>> dict >>>> > lookup. But replacing somehow the string compare IMO would definitely >>>> worth >>>> > it. >>>> > But these are only ideas I don't know OCC's structure very well. >>>> >>>> I guess that >>>> hasattr(obj_deleted,"GetHandle") >>>> can be replaced by >>>> isinstance(deleted, OCC.Standard.Standard_Transient) or >>>> isinstance(deleted, OCC.Standard.Standard_Persistent) >>>> >>> >>> Absolutely.
